The postcode DA15 8QN is located in Bexley,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DA15 8QN is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DA15 8QN is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DA15 8QN as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.

The closest road name to DA15 8QN is Queenswood Road which is centered 83 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Queenswood Road and is 170 m away. The closest railway station is Falconwood Rail Station, 1.4 km away.

The closest primary school to DA15 8QN (for ages 11 and under) is Our Lady of the Rosary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on January 16, 2020.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Harris Academy Falconwood. The last OFSTED inspection on October 17, 2019 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of DA15 8QN is The Jolly Fenman and is 195 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on March 3,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Yak Land and is 453 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 8,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 131.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DA15 8QN is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Bexley is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
